How much do commission sports performance analyst j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for commission sports performance analyst in the United States is $75,189.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$55,000.00 and $89,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

The Arena Club, located in Bel Air Maryland, is currently seeking highly motivated Personal Trainers and/or Sports Performance coaches to join our team of professionals. Personal Trainers and/or Sports Performance Coaches are expected to take a proactive role in client and member engagement to provide exemplary service.

Interested applicants must be comfortable working with a wide range of populations and demonstrate proficiency in designing safe and appropriate exercise prescription for these populations.

Additionally, candidates must be a team player and demonstrate excellent customer service, organizational skills, communication and positive attitude.

Competitive candidates have a diverse knowledge of the fitness industry with a minimum of 6 months experience. Completion of, or enrollment in, Bachelor's Degree program in Exercise Science or related field is preferred but not required. Current CPR with AED is required in addition to a nationally accredited personal training or sports performance certification (NASM, ACSM, NSCA, NSPA, ACE, etc.).

Facility and Benefits: The Arena Club is a total Health and Wellness center that offers member services such as Personal Training, Weight Loss Programming, Small Group Training, Strength and Conditioning, Sport Specific Training, Group Exercise, Medical/Physician's Referred Exercise Programming, Aquatics and other Wellness services. The Arena Club offers the highest commissions in the area for personal trainers and sports performance coaches. Additionally, full time employees can receive the following benefits: paid time off, 401K investment programs and medical, dental and/or vision insurance.
